Keeping this in view, how wide should a crochet baby cocoon be?

This cocoon measures approximately 18” tall by 8.25” wide (when laid flat). It is suitable for an average sized newborn with a good amount of stretch, as well as plenty of length to accommodate longer babies (or to be tucked under shorter ones).

Also, can a newborn sleep in a DockATot? The DockATot is designed as an in-bed co-sleeper. Co-sleeping is one of the biggest risk factors for infant sleep deaths. Safe Sleep Experts agree that there is no "safe co-sleeping." Placing the DockATot in a crib, bassinet or other sleep surface is against the manufacturer's warnings and is not safe.

Can you put a dock a tot in a crib?

Can I use my dock in a crib, bassinet and/or play yard? No. DockATot should not be used in a crib, bassinet or play yard. The Consumer Product Safety Commission has cautioned that babies should be placed in a bare crib without any additional bedding, blankets or pillows.

Can baby sleep in baby nest?

Items such as cushioned sleeping pods, nests, baby hammocks, cot bumpers, pillows, duvets and anything that wedges or straps a baby in place can pose a risk to babies under 12 months. They can lead overheating or potentially obstruct a baby's airway if they roll or their face becomes covered by loose bedding.

How do you knit a baby hat in the round?

Basic Easy Baby Hat Knitting Pattern Instructions
Using long-tail cast on, cast on 72 stitches onto your circular needles. Join to knit in the round and knit 1 stitch, purl 1 stitch in a rib stitch for 4 rounds. Then knit all rounds until the hat is about 5 inches long.

Do babies need hats?

When babies are born, they come out of a warm, moist environment – the womb – and into one that can be downright chilly. But after your newborn leaves the hospital, he doesn't need to wear a hat at all times unless it's fall or winter or your house is very cold.

What is a double crochet?

Double Crochet. Double crochet is a taller stitch than single crochet. It is formed by a "yarn over," which is wrapping yarn from back to front before placing the hook in the stitch. Yarn over and pull through 2 loops on the hook. Yarn over again and pull through remaining 2 loops.
